What can he say about a person. What can you learn about a person by one appearance. What sharp handwriting says about character

There is such a science as graphology, which determines the character of a person by his handwriting. But it should be noted that this science is not universal, that is, one cannot judge a person only by his handwriting. Firstly, character is a rather complicated thing, and secondly, there are also exceptions to the rules. But still, graphology gives a certain idea of ​​the character of a person.

According to a study by Israeli scientists, graphology - the science of analyzing handwriting, much more accurately than the well-known lie detector, determines the honesty and dishonesty of the author of the handwriting. In addition, graphology allows you to clearly define the character and mood of a person.

Today, thanks to the analysis of handwriting, it is possible to find out the mental potential of a person, his activity, ability to learn, independence, efficiency, communication skills, stress resistance, self-control, ambition, reliability, law-abidingness and much, much more.
